Sunday, April 7th, presents a delightful mix of activities in Thunder Bay to suit various interests. The day starts with the Female Boarder Collective Sunday Skates at Cinema 5 Skatepark, providing a fun and active way for enthusiasts to enjoy the morning. Meanwhile, the Thunder Bay Psychic And Crystal Fair, as well as the 26th Annual Home And Garden Show and Spring Home & Garden Show 2024, offer opportunities to explore metaphysical concepts and gather inspiration for home improvement projects.
For those interested in crafts, the Macrame for Beginners Workshop provides a creative outlet for participants aged 12 and above. Adventure seekers can head to Loch Lomond Ski Area for the Slush Cup 2024, where skiers and snowboarders take on the challenge of crossing a pool of slush in style.
In the evening, Cinema 5 Skatepark hosts 35 Plus Skateboarding, fostering a sense of community and camaraderie among skateboarders. Additionally, Magnus Theatre offers a range of programs tailored for different age groups, including Magnus Youth, Magnus Minis, and Magnus Tots, providing opportunities for young performers to develop their skills and express their creativity in a supportive environment.
With such a diverse array of activities, Sunday in Thunder Bay promises something for everyone to enjoy, whether it's outdoor adventure, creative exploration, or artistic expression.
